  1. Hi all So I manage to drop a bit of metal into the cigarette lighter of my A3 and blue the fuse, which was easy to replace. Unfortunately, although the boot cigarette lighter is now working, the front cigarette lighter still wasn't working and I thought I had damaged it. I decided to upgrade to a CHGeek QC3.0 Dual USB Charger Socket but still having problems and wonder if there could be a deeper problem. When I wire in the usb charge socket, the only way I can get it to work is with the grey blue wire plugged in as +12v and the brown wire as -12v AND the lights on. I think I shouldn't be running this as I think the grey/blue it only to provide the illumination on the old cigarette lighter. No other combination works and the red/black wire doesn't do anything. Can anyone provide some suggestions? Thanks
